#1 rule- There should be only 1 DHCP server on your LAN. Usually your router. Be aware that AP's, many cams, dvr's and other devices all have built in DHCP servers that are usually on by default. They must all be turned OFF. while the devices are all set to DHCP and not static. And devices all on the same subnet mask.
A good router's server will ID your devices based on it's MAC address. It does not care about it's IP address since it will change it to join your LAN. That's how it works. Of course you get to tell your DHCP server WHAT ip you want this device to operate under in the settings.
From this point, troubleshooting, managing or configuring your LAN become a one stop shop inside your router. That is how it is done.
